Sri Krsna kirtane Jadi Manasa Tohar

Song Name: Sri Krsna kirtane Jadi Manasa Tohar

Author: Bhaktivinoda Thakura

Book Name: Gitavali
(Section: Siksastakam Song 3)

(1)

śrī-kṛṣṇa-kīrtane jadi mānasa tohār
parama jatane tāhi labho adhikār

(2)

tṛnādhika hīna, dīna, akishcana chār
āpane mānobi sadā chāḍi’ ahańkār

(3)

vṛkṣa-sama kṣamā-guna korobi sādhan
prati-hiṁsā tyaji’ anye korobi pālan

(4)

jīvana-nirvāhe āne udvega nā dibe
para-upakāre nija-sukha pāsaribe

(5)

hoile-o sarva-gune gunī mahāśoy
pratiṣṭhāśā chāḍi koro amani hṛdoy

(6)

kṛṣṇa-adhiṣṭhāna sarva-jive jāni’ sadā
korobi sammāna sabe ādare sarvadā

(7)

dainya, doyā, anye māna, pratiṣṭhā-varjan
cāri gune gunī hoi’ koroha kīrtan

(8)

bhakativinoda kāńdi’, bole prabhu-pāy
heno adhikāra kabe dibe he āmāy

TRANSLATION


1) If your mind is always absorbed in chanting the glories of Lord Krsna with great care, then by
that process of Sri-krsna-kirtana you will attain transcendental qualification.

2) You should give up all false pride and always consider yourself to be worthless, destitute, lower
and more humble than a blade of grass.

3) You should practice forgiveness like that of a tree, and giving up violence toward other living beings,
you should protect and maintain them.

4) In the course of passing your life, you should never give anxiety to others, but rather do good to
them while forgetting about your own happiness.

5) When one has thus become a great soul, possessing all good qualities, one should abandon all
desires for fame and honor and make one's heart humble.

6) Knowing that Lord Krsna resides within all living creatures, one should with great respect
consistently show honor to all beings.

7) By possessing these four qualities-humility, mercifulness, respect toward others, and the renunciation
of desires for prestige-one becomes virtuous. In such a state you may sing the glories of the Supreme Lord.

8) Weeping, Bhaktivinoda submits his prayer at the lotus feet of the Lord: "O Lord, when will you give
me the qualification for possessing attributes such as these?"
